NT DOCOMO: Five
Companies to Set Up Fabless Communication Platform Joint Venture Company
December 28, 2011
NTT
DOCOMO has reached a basic agreement with five companies — Fujitsu,
Fujitsu Semiconductor, NEC, Panasonic Mobile Communications and Samsung
Electronics — to establish a fabless joint venture company by the end of
March 2012 to develop and sell semiconductor products for mobile
devices.
The joint venture company, leveraging the six investing companies’
strong backgrounds in cellular communication technology and vast
experience in application specific integrated circuits (ASIC) design and
foundry manufacturing, will develop feature-rich, small-size,
low-power-consumption semiconductor products equipped with modem
functionality. The joint venture company will focus on developing
products for LTE and LTE-Advanced mobile communication standards. The
products will be sold in markets globally.
The envisioned joint venture company will be formed once all parties
agree on the details, which are now being worked out through
consultation. Following the basic agreement announced today, and as part
of preparing to form the joint venture company, DOCOMO plans to invest
450 million Japanese yen, or about 5.8 million USD*, to establish a
wholly owned subsidiary, called Communication Platform Planning Co.,
Ltd. and headed by CEO Mitsunobu Komori, concurrently an executive vice
president and Chief Technical Officer of DOCOMO, by the middle of
January. |
